Chicken Horn Powder

Chicken Horn Powder,For bites by a sky snake.

Formulas Name : Chicken Horn Powder

Chinese Name : 鸡角散

Drug Formulation

Egg white, soapberry.

Source

From *Collected Medical Formulas* (Vol. 167), citing *Proven Effective Formulas*.

Benefits

For bites by a sky snake.

Instructions for Use

First, brush the inside of the wound with egg white; when itching occurs, burn soap pods, grind them into a powder, and apply it to the wound.
